How does your game fit the theme?
The game involves a clock that you have to manipulate every level to count down slightly further than before. In the meantime, various apocalyptic scenes play out in the background.

This is such a creative idea, both in the context of the theme and just in general! I've never seen a game focused on manipulating an analog clock using the indivdual display segments, and it's executed so incredibly well! There were multiple ways to increase and decrease the amount of lighted segments and multiple ways to move them around, both within the individual number and between numbers. It was also the perfect amount of challenge; I never felt too lost on a puzzle, but I definitely had to work towards the solutions. When I finally figured out a puzzle, it felt amazing!
